도리안의 개발 이야기 #138 - DB 학습 중: INSERT, UPDATE, DELETE

in #kr-dev5 years ago



대문 제작: imrahelk

이번에는 데이터베이스의 자료를 추가, 수정, 삭제할 수 있는 INSERT, UPDATE, DELETE문에 대해 복습을 했습니다. 기본적인 사용방법은 알고 있었지만, 몰랐던 부분들이 있었습니다. 아직 사용하지는 않았지만, (제게) 새로운 것들을 배워두면, 훗날 개발하는데 도움이 많이 됩니다. 이번에 새로 배운 내용은요.

  • 테이블에 AUTO_INCREMENT 적용후 증가한 최근 컬럼 값 확인 방법
  • INSERT 문에 SELECT 문을 추가하여 데이터 대량 입력 방법
  • DELTE 문과 TRUNCATE 문으로 테이블 전체 자료 삭제시 실행 시간 차이
  • INSERT 문에 IGNORE 키워드 추가하여 중단되지 않고 자료 계속 입력하기
  • INSERT 문 실행시 중복 문제가 발생하면 UPDATE 문 실행 방법

샘플 테이블과 쿼리를 만드는 게 좋겠다는 말씀을 저번 포스트에서 드렸지요. 다음 포스트에서 한번 만들어보면 좋을 거 같습니다. 개발이라는 게 손으로 직접 실습해 보는 게 가장 빨리 배우고 익히는 방법이니까요. 그게 이번 주말의 과제가 되겠습니다.

aaronhong_banner.jpg

Sort:  

big-tree-3443533_960_720.jpg

아낌없이 주는 나무 보팅하고갑니다^^

오늘의 링크 : https://steemit.com/kr/@best-live/7sioox-tree-bank
내용 : 아낌없이 주는 나무 상생 프로젝트 두번째인 tree-bank 제도를 알립니다:)

아낌없이주는 나무에 대한 후원으로 왔어요. 미약하나마 보팅 하고 가요.

Posted using Partiko Android

Coin Marketplace

STEEM 0.35
TRX 0.12
JST 0.040
BTC 70733.96
ETH 3563.16
USDT 1.00
SBD 4.76